FS127-S Invalid name mapping command.

See the section Filename Mapping in the chapter Advanced Operation and the section Database Reference File Maintenance in the chapter Database Integrity for more information on the /fs option.

Resolution:

If the option has been specified on the command line, include the /af option to specify the name of the replacement string value and retry the operation.

If the option is specified in a database reference file, this error indicates that the database reference file has become corrupt or has been changed without using the Database Reference File Maintenance Utility.

In this situation, it may be possible to remove the invalid entry using a normal text editor. If this is unsuccessful, discard the current database reference file and create a new one using the Database Reference File Maintenance Utility.
